Familiarizing yourself with How to Use a Portable Fire Extinguisher Properly
To employ a handheld fire extinguisher safely, remember the acronym P.A.S.S.: Pull the pin , direct the hose at the foundation of the fire , depress the trigger, and sweep the nozzle from side to side. Before attempting to put out a blaze, ensure you have an exit and are a reasonable distance – typically 6-10 feet – from the alight material. Avoid fight a significant or rapidly spreading fire; instead, evacuate and call the professionals. Annual inspection and upkeep of your extinguisher is also crucial .

Emergency First: Learning about Portable Combustion Suppressor Kinds
When the comes to your protection , knowing the several kinds of handheld fire suppressors is essential . There are usually four primary categories: Type A, best used on standard combustibles like wood ; Class B, effective against flammable materials like gasoline ; Type C, intended for energized blazes ; and Class D, uniquely for metal materials . Be sure to verify the markings to identify the appropriate suppression tool for the potential hazard .
